I had my baby at 27 weeks. I am producing more milk than she is taking in. I currently have a full deep freezer and going to invest in a 2nd one. I feel like I will probably fill that one before she gets out of the NICU, too. I can't donate to a milkbank because I had a blood transfusion after my c-section and growth hormone shots as a kid. Otherwise I don't drink or do drugs or smoke. I also didn't do a good job at keeping track of how much milk is in each bag/bottle before freezing it, so that makes it too difficult to sell. I would love to give some milk to a mom in need. With my husband being military, the hospital provides bottles, but I started pumping into bags too. So I have some of both, if you choose to have the bottles, I don't need anything in return, but if you want it in a bag please give me a bag in return for each bag of milk I give you.
